The Significance of Organic Viticulture


Organic viticulture emphasizes the combination of eco lasting practices in grape growing. This technique highlights the importance of soil health and wellness, biodiversity, and the decrease of artificial inputs, which eventually contribute to the high quality of a glass of wine created.


Principles of Natural Farming


Natural farming is rooted in a couple of key principles. First, it prioritizes the health of the soil. Healthy soil fosters a robust community that supports plant growth.


Crop rotation and cover cropping are typically employed to maintain soil integrity. This approach lowers disintegration, raises raw material, and boosts nutrition cycling.


Second, chemical-free farming practices encourage biodiversity. By advertising a variety of plants and wild animals, wineries develop resilience versus parasites and illness. Natural killers can properly regulate dangerous types without chemicals.


Lastly, staying clear of artificial pesticides and plant foods assists safeguard both the setting and the white wine's purity. Organic wineries utilize all-natural options like composting and bio-based insect control to boost grape high quality sustainably.


Regulatory Requirements and Certifications


Organic viticulture is regulated by strict guidelines and accreditations. In the USA, the USDA sets nationwide organic criteria that cover production, taking care of, and labeling.


To be certified natural, wineries need to adhere to certain guidelines for a minimum of 3 years. This period enables the dirt to recover from chemical inputs, guaranteeing the end product fulfills organic requirements.


Qualification involves routine assessments, documentation, and compliance with organic methods. Numerous companies provide accreditation, consisting of The golden state Qualified Organic Farmers (CCOF) and Oregon Tilth.


Certification labels need to be plainly mentioned on bottle. They inform consumers the red wine was created according to natural standards, advertising openness and count on the item.


Sonoma's Terroir and Environment


Sonoma Area's unique terroir and climate play important duties in the top quality and personality of its natural white wines. The mix of soil types and microclimates allows for diverse grape varietals to thrive, adding to the area's abundant viticultural landscape.


Effect On Grape Varietals


Sonoma's different landscapes include seaside arrays, valleys, and hillsides, each supplying unique conditions for grape growth. The well-drained dirts vary from volcanic to sandy, promoting root deepness and flavor concentration.


Popular varietals consist of Pinot Noir, which grows in the cooler coastal regions, and Cabernet Sauvignon, fit for warmer inland locations like Napa Valley. Notably, Chardonnay thrives in Sonoma's varied microclimates, creating red wines with both richness and level of acidity.


Climate additionally plays a crucial function in the ripening procedure. Constant sunshine coupled with awesome night breezes allows grapes to establish complex tastes while keeping level of acidity vital for balance.


Impact of Microclimates


Microclimates in Sonoma County substantially affect the grapes' advancement and features. Coastal regions experience cooler temperature levels and fog impact, perfect for delicate varietals.


These problems prolong the growing period, allowing grapes to establish nuanced tastes and elegance. In contrast, inland locations enjoy warmer days and cooler nights, cultivating bold varietals with rich, robust tastes.


A noteworthy example is the "Russian River Valley," where trendy currents contribute to outstanding Pinot Noir. These distinct microclimates enable winemakers to customize their winery techniques to boost grape quality and a glass of wine accounts. Understanding these nuances informs vineyard administration and winemaking methods, eventually forming Sonoma's popular natural glass of wines.


Organic Wine Production Techniques


Organic wine production involves careful consideration of both the winery procedures and wine making techniques. The focus stays on sustainable practices that enhance the all-natural features of the grapes without artificial additives or chemicals.


Gathering and Fermentation


Harvesting in natural wine making commonly happens at ideal ripeness, often done by hand to ensure minimal damages to the grapes. This cautious selection procedure makes certain that only the finest fruit is used.


After collecting, fermentation starts with a focus on all-natural yeasts, which are present on the grape skins or in the winery atmosphere. The use of these aboriginal yeasts adds unique tastes and aromas to the wine.


Temperature level control during fermentation is critical, enabling winemakers to influence the wine's taste account while protecting its natural stability. Routine punch-downs or pump-overs during fermentation aid enhance color removal and tannin development in merlots.


Aging and Bottling


Aging organic white wines can entail a range of vessels, including oak barrels or stainless-steel storage tanks, depending on the desired style. The selection of aging vessel can considerably affect the wine's flavor and appearance.


Organic wines are typically bottled without the enhancement of sulfites or with very low levels, keeping wellness and taste integrity in mind. Before bottling, the wine undergoes filtering to eliminate any kind of debris, ensuring clarity and stability.


Labeling methods for organic white wines additionally play an important role, as certification needs to be plainly mentioned. These techniques stress openness and adherence to natural standards, even more strengthening the white wine's market charm.

Sustainability and Future Patterns


The white wine sector is significantly concentrating on lasting techniques and cutting-edge strategies that focus on ecological health and wellness. Comprehending the difficulties and chances within organic winemaking is vital for shaping future fads.


Technologies in Organic Wine Making


Current improvements in organic winemaking consist of using precision viticulture. This technology permits wine makers to keep an eye on vine health and dirt conditions through sensing units and drones. By gathering data, they can make enlightened decisions on irrigation and parasite administration, which decreases chemical treatment.


One more emerging fad is regenerative agriculture, which boosts dirt health and wellness and biodiversity. Techniques such as cover chopping and reduced husbandry are acquiring appeal. These techniques not just enhance grape top quality however additionally produce an extra durable ecosystem.


Furthermore, natural fermentation procedures are being welcomed much more extensively. Utilizing indigenous yeast from the winery can enhance the white wine's flavor profile and local color. This fad respects the regional setting and promotes individuality in wine ranges.


Obstacles and Opportunities


While sustainability holds promise, it likewise provides obstacles. Transitioning to organic farming can require considerable financial investment in regards to time and sources. Growers should adapt to new techniques and might encounter first declines in return.


Market need for natural wines is growing, creating opportunities for producers. Consumers increasingly seek transparency in sourcing and production practices. This trend motivates winemakers to adopt lasting techniques, which can bring about greater costs and boosted commitment among eco-conscious buyers.


Additionally, environment adjustment postures dangers to standard winemaking regions. Adjusting to moving weather condition patterns is necessary for preserving grape quality. This situation develops chances for development in grape varieties and winery administration techniques.
